I have a multiboot system of NT, 2k, XP and 2003 for test purposes.
While trying to backup a folder of saved webpage articles I created in MyDocuments in XP I get an error no matter what OS I am booted into.
For example when in 2k I got the following error:
ERROR COPYING FILE OR FOLDER
-cannot copy file: File system error (1148)

There is enough disk space for the copy, there are no encrypted files or folders in this directory, there are no special attributes at all, except I have some long folder and file names that Windows accepted upon creation so I assumed they were ok, but when I tried to "reset permissions on all child objects and enable propagation of inheritable permissions", I got this error for several files and folders:

ERROR APPLYING SECURITY
- The filename, directory name, or volume label syntax is incorrect

So I went to one of those directories mentioned in the above error and tried to copy the actual folder it mentioned and nothing happens, so I tried the one next to it that has a very similar long filename and got the following error:

ERROR COPYING FILE OR FOLDER
- Cannot copy file: The filename you specified is invalid or too long. Specify a different filename.

I also cannot even open some of these folders or right click on them and get properties.

I ran a virus scan, scandisk, etc and no problems !!


*******
Is there anyway to copy these files and folders with a registry edit or a 3rd party product ????

I tried doing so from every OS on my multiboot system and failed.
